Position Purpose:

The Process Improvement Specialist serves as a key contributor within the Process Ownership team, responsible for driving end-to-end process optimization across Claims and Configuration operations. This role partners closely with process owners, operations leaders, and cross-functional stakeholders to define current-state processes, design scalable future-state solutions, and ensure sustainable adoption of standard work. Using LEAN, Six Sigma, Plan-Do-Study-Act (PDSA), and related methodologies, the Specialist leads improvement initiatives that enhance quality, efficiency, compliance, and provider experience while supporting enterprise growth.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ead enterprise and department-level process improvement initiatives from intake through sustainment, with accountability for outcomes
  • Facilitate current-state and future-state process mapping, including identification of variation, waste, risk, and control gaps
  • Partner with designated Process Owners to define clear ownership, decision rights, metrics, and escalation paths
  • Translate operational complexity into standardized workflows, procedures, and handoffs suitable for documentation and training
  • Apply data-driven analysis to identify root causes, quantify impact, and prioritize improvement opportunities
  • Serve as a trusted advisor to leaders by providing structured problem-solving, insights, and recommendations

Education/Experience:
Bachelor's degree in related field or equivalent experience. 4+ years of LEAN, Six Sigma or similar process improvement experience within the healthcare industry preferred. Previous working knowledge of process mapping and design, statistical applications and project management software.
Licenses/Certifications: LEAN/Six Sigma Green Belt, CAPM-PMI - Certified Associate of Project Management preferred. Black Belt or PMP preferred.

What you need to know about the Toronto Tech Scene

Although home to some of the biggest names in tech, including Google, Microsoft and Amazon, Toronto has established itself as one of the largest startup ecosystems in the world. And with over 2,000 startups — more than 30 percent of the country's total startups — Toronto continues to attract new businesses. Be it helping entrepreneurs manage their finances, simplifying business operations by automating payroll or assisting pharmaceutical companies in launching new drugs, the city's tech scene is just getting started.
